Ok, Eagle 05 Coming In!

We are a Canadian family that loves to spend time together and travel with a huge Love for Disney World. However we quickly learned that with 3 kids now aged 4-10 that trips like that no longer come cheap. Having seen this coming for a while now we started our research about 3 years ago and took the plunge at the end of July and bought a 2017 Jayco Greyhawk 31fs. The wife and I being Spaceballs fanatics we naturally had to baptize the rv "Eagle 5". Neither my wife nor I had ever towed anything at all in our lives therefor the Class C made sense to us. The layout works great for us as well giving all 3 kids their own space. ( oldest over the cab and 2 youngest in the bunks, not to mention they all have their own tv's) we picked up the coach on August 12 and have been out twice so far. Few minor items have come up, nothing serious and mainly cosmetic. That was the Reason it was important to us to get it now as opposed to the spring so that our Dealer could do the warranty fixes over the winter. This forum has been great so far as I have learned a lot and am looking forward to participate more in the future.
